Over the years, the trend of using plastic furniture has increased rapidly. Plastic furniture has achieved great market success. Plastic furniture is light in weight, durable, waterproof, easy to transport, cheap, beautiful, and can be made into various colors and designs, mainly used in catering, gardens, homes and offices. Therefore, plastic Chair Mould have become the focus of commercial investment.

Considering mold cost and customer investment, P20 steel is mainly used for cores and cavities, but 718 steel is a very good steel for high quality and mirror polishing of cores and cavities. These molds require highly polished, mold flow analysis and proper exhaust. The hardness of the steel plays a vital role in the service life of the mold. Flashes on the ends and sides of the product should be avoided, and other types of defects in the mold should be avoided.

Be extremely careful when assembling the chair mold and check all parts accurately, including the cooling system, hydraulic oil channel system, hot runner, template, thimble, stripper, thimble block or slider system. Interchangeable backrest inserts help to obtain new chair designs.
